Reconstruction:Proto-Finnic/veeras
Proto-Finnic
Etymology
Probably *veeri (“side, edge”) + *-as (the suffix is a variant of *-s), albeit this etymology is not without doubt. Semantically, the original sense could have been “someone who lives on the side or on the edge”, i.e. outside one's own location, hence a stranger.
Another possibility is borrowing from Proto-Germanic *weraz (“man”) (compare Old Norse verr) or Proto-Balto-Slavic *wī́ˀras (“man, male”) (compare Lithuanian výras (“man, husband”)).

Descendants
- Estonian: võõras
- Finnish: vieras
- Ingrian: veeras
- Karelian:
- Livonian: vȭrõz
- Livvi: vieras
- Ludian: vieraz
- Veps: veraz
- Võro: võõras
- Votic: võõrõz
- → Proto-Samic: *vierēs
